The cheapest way to get from Manila to Malabuyoc is to ferry which costs ₱1,700 - ₱4,000 and takes 29h 49m.
The fastest way to get from Manila to Malabuyoc is to fly and ferry which takes 4h 21m and costs ₱5,500 - ₱9,500.
No, there is no direct bus from Manila to Malabuyoc. However, there are services departing from Ceres Cubao Terminal, Manila and arriving at Samboan Cebu via Dumaguete and Liloan Port.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 29h 24m.
No, there is no direct ferry from Manila to Malabuyoc. However, there are services departing from Manila and arriving at Liloan via Sibulan.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 29h 49m.
The distance between Manila and Malabuyoc is 672 km.

What companies run services between Manila, Philippines and Malabuyoc, Philippines?
Ceres Transport operates a vehicle from Ceres Cubao Terminal, Manila to Dumaguete Ceres Bus Terminal once daily. Tickets cost ₱3,100–3,400 and the journey takes 26h. Alternatively, you can take a ferry from Manila to Malabuyoc via Dumaguete Port, Sibulan, and Liloan in around 29h 49m.
